Continuum extrapolated high order baryon fluctuations

Szabolcs Borsányi🇩🇪 · Zoltán Fodor🇩🇪 · Jana N. Guenther🇩🇪 · Sándor D. Katz🇭🇺 · Paolo Parotto🇺🇸 · Attila Pásztor🇭🇺 · Dávid Pesznyák🇭🇺 · Kálmán K. Szabó🇩🇪 · Chik Him Wong🇩🇪

Abstract

Fluctuations play a key role in the study of QCD phases. Lattice QCD is a valuable tool to calculate them, but going to high orders is challenging. Up to the fourth order, continuum results are available since 2015. We present the first continuum results for sixth order baryon fluctuations for temperatures between MeV, and eighth order at MeV in a fixed volume. We show that for MeV, relevant for criticality search, finite volume effects are under control. Our results are in sharp contrast with well known results in the literature obtained at finite lattice spacing.
